smudge
🖌️
smudge
noun/verb
/smʌdʒ/
Meaning
a dirty mark or smear; to make something dirty or unclear by rubbing or touching
Example Sentences
She accidentally smudged her lipstick on the napkin.
Example Expressions
leave a smudge
Synonyms
stain, smear, blot, blur, mark
Antonyms
clean, polish, clarity
Collocations
ink smudge, smudge mark, smudge on glass, smudge proof
